SK64 VWR is a 2014 Ford S-max in White with a 1,560cc diesel engine. This vehicle has been through 13 MOT tests with a personal pass rate of 69.2%.
Across all 2014 Ford S-max models, the average MOT pass rate is 77.4% with a typical mileage of 64,256 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Ford S-max f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 26,089 recorded failures. If you're considering buying SK64 VWR, it's worth having these areas checked by a mechanic before committing.
The Ford S-max typically stays on UK roads for around 20 years. At 12 years old, this Ford S-max is well into its expected lifespan but still has years ahead.
